Tutorial 2: How to add and remove various tool bars

After loading IE9, things are going to look different from the previous versions. For example one common question is “Where is the print button?” Therefore, it is important to be aware of your surroundings since we usually don’t thing of these things until we need them. Knowing how to pull up specific tool bars at specified times will keep the webpage less cluttered and running faster.
Directions on how to customize by adding and removing tool bars:

1.      Right click next to a tab page so a drop down menu appears

2.      Select Menu Bar and Command Bar so check marks appears next to them


3.      Icons for Menu Bar and Command Bar should appear above webpage


4.      Hide the Menu Bar by right click next to tab page (like in Step # 1) and click the check mark to unselect the Menu bar.
